Charles

Charles is a boy's name that peaked in 1947, when it was the 9th most popular in the United States. In 2025 it ranked 48th. About 1.2 million Charleses are alive in the United States today, and half of them are over 59.

Of the 2,447,135 babies given the name since 1880, about 1.2 million are alive — 49 in every hundred. Roughly 119,000 of them are children and 478,000 are 65 or over. The dotted line is the median: half were born before 1966 and half after.

An estimate, not a count. SSA births aged forward through SSA cohort life tables, which know nothing about who left the country or arrived in it — so for a name that mostly came to America rather than being born in it, this is a floor rather than a figure. Where you fall among living Americans.

Where the name comes from

Origin Germanic languages

From French Charles, from Old French Charles, Carles, from Latin Carolus, and also reinfluenced by Frankish and Old High German Karl, from Proto-Germanic *karilaz (“free man”); compare the English word churl and the German Kerl. In reference to the Ecuadorian island, a clipping of the original name King Charles's Island, granted in honor of Charles II of England.

Where Charles is most common

Relative to how many babies each state records, Charles is most concentrated in West Virginia (2.1×), Kentucky (1.7×), the District of Columbia (1.7×), Mississippi (1.6×).

Where Charles lives in Spain

Not a count of births but of people: 676 men called Charles were living in Spain on 1 January 2025, of every age, born in any year. Where they live is not spread evenly.
